CoWin: A Product of Indian Innovation

The CoWin platform is entirely an Indian initiative, developed by the Ministry of Health and Family Welfare (MoHFW) with the support of the National Health Authority (NHA). It was conceptualized and built by a team of Indian engineers and developers, under the guidance of the MoHFW and NHA. The platform’s development was a collaborative effort involving various stakeholders, including the Indian government, technology companies, and public health experts.

Key Features and Capabilities of CoWin

CoWin is a robust digital platform designed to manage the entire vaccination process efficiently and transparently. Its core functionalities include:

  • Registration and Appointment Scheduling: Individuals can register on the platform and book vaccination appointments at their preferred locations and times.
  • Vaccination Tracking and Certification: The platform keeps a record of each individual’s vaccination status and generates a digital vaccination certificate that can be used for various purposes.
  • Real-Time Data and Analytics: CoWin collects and analyzes real-time data on vaccination coverage, enabling authorities to monitor progress and identify potential areas of concern.
  • Scalability and Flexibility: The platform was designed to handle a massive influx of users and has been continually upgraded to accommodate evolving needs and challenges.

1. Is CoWIN a Chinese Company?

No, CoWIN is not a Chinese company. It is a platform developed by the Ministry of Health and Family Welfare (MoHFW), Government of India. The development of CoWIN was undertaken by the National Informatics Centre (NIC), an organization under the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ology (MeitY). While there might be some technical components or third-party software used in CoWIN’s infrastructure, the core development and ownership remain with Indian entities.
